    You can see knocking occurring in cylinders 1 and 4 after applying oxygen fuel. The fuel ignites when the piston is on its way to the compression stage. This creates two opposing forces: the piston attempting to move upward and pre-ignition or knock trying to push the piston downward. Consequently, the crankshaft fails to tolerate these reverse forces.
